How to use PHP to implement product recommendation function
With the continuous development of e-commerce, product recommendation function has become an indispensable part of all websites. The product recommendation function can provide users with a more personalized shopping experience, thereby increasing website user activity and conversion rates. As one of the most popular web development languages, PHP can implement the product recommendation function very well. This article will introduce how to use PHP to implement product recommendation function.
1. Collect user data
The most important thing about the product recommendation function is the need to collect enough user data. We can understand the user's shopping preferences through the user's purchase history, browsing history and other information, so as to recommend more relevant products to them. In actual development, we can use Cookie, Session, LocalStorage and other technologies to collect and store user data.
2. Recommendation algorithm based on collaborative filtering
Collaborative filtering is a common recommendation algorithm. Its basic idea is to establish a similarity model between users, and then recommend users with high similarity to them. Products of. Before using the collaborative filtering algorithm, we need to label products and users so that they can be processed and compared by computers. Before implementing the recommendation algorithm based on collaborative filtering, we need to use PHP to parse the label data of products and users and store it as a data structure to facilitate subsequent algorithm calculations.
3. Recommendation algorithm based on content filtering
In addition to the collaborative filtering algorithm, the recommendation algorithm based on content filtering is also a common recommendation algorithm. Its principle is to analyze the content characteristics of products. Thereby recommending products that are similar to the user's browsing history. Before using the content-based filtering algorithm, we need to use PHP to parse the product content and extract its features, such as name, description, tags and other information, and store these features as data structures.
4. Combination recommendation algorithm
In addition to a single algorithm, it is also a common practice to combine multiple recommendation algorithms. In the combined recommendation algorithm, we can use weight combination, optimization algorithm and other methods to obtain more accurate recommendation results.
5. Implement recommendation algorithm
Implementing the recommendation algorithm needs to be designed based on specific application scenarios. We can use PHP combined with the above algorithms to calculate recommendation results based on user data and product data, and present the results to the user. Recommended results can be displayed on the page, sent via email, etc. to interact with users.
6. Optimize recommendation algorithm
Recommendation algorithms are developing very rapidly, and new algorithms and technologies are constantly emerging. Therefore, optimizing the recommendation algorithm is an important aspect of realizing the product recommendation function. We can use methods such as A/B testing to compare different recommendation algorithms and strategies to obtain more accurate and useful recommendation results.

JWT is an open standard based on JSON, used to securely transmit information between parties, mainly for identity authentication and information exchange. 1. JWT consists of three parts: Header, Payload and Signature. 2. The working principle of JWT includes three steps: generating JWT, verifying JWT and parsing Payload. 3. When using JWT for authentication in PHP, JWT can be generated and verified, and user role and permission information can be included in advanced usage. 4. Common errors include signature verification failure, token expiration, and payload oversized. Debugging skills include using debugging tools and logging. 5. Session hijacking can be achieved through the following steps: 1. Obtain the session ID, 2. Use the session ID, 3. Keep the session active. The methods to prevent session hijacking in PHP include: 1. Use the session_regenerate_id() function to regenerate the session ID, 2. Store session data through the database, 3. Ensure that all session data is transmitted through HTTPS.

The enumeration function in PHP8.1 enhances the clarity and type safety of the code by defining named constants. 1) Enumerations can be integers, strings or objects, improving code readability and type safety. 2) Enumeration is based on class and supports object-oriented features such as traversal and reflection. 3) Enumeration can be used for comparison and assignment to ensure type safety. 4) Enumeration supports adding methods to implement complex logic. 5) Strict type checking and error handling can avoid common errors. 6) Enumeration reduces magic value and improves maintainability, but pay attention to performance optimization.

The application of SOLID principle in PHP development includes: 1. Single responsibility principle (SRP): Each class is responsible for only one function. 2. Open and close principle (OCP): Changes are achieved through extension rather than modification. 3. Lisch's Substitution Principle (LSP): Subclasses can replace base classes without affecting program accuracy. 4. Interface isolation principle (ISP): Use fine-grained interfaces to avoid dependencies and unused methods. 5. Dependency inversion principle (DIP): High and low-level modules rely on abstraction and are implemented through dependency injection.

Static binding (static::) implements late static binding (LSB) in PHP, allowing calling classes to be referenced in static contexts rather than defining classes. 1) The parsing process is performed at runtime, 2) Look up the call class in the inheritance relationship, 3) It may bring performance overhead.

RESTAPI design principles include resource definition, URI design, HTTP method usage, status code usage, version control, and HATEOAS. 1. Resources should be represented by nouns and maintained at a hierarchy. 2. HTTP methods should conform to their semantics, such as GET is used to obtain resources. 3. The status code should be used correctly, such as 404 means that the resource does not exist. 4. Version control can be implemented through URI or header. 5. HATEOAS boots client operations through links in response.

In PHP, exception handling is achieved through the try, catch, finally, and throw keywords. 1) The try block surrounds the code that may throw exceptions; 2) The catch block handles exceptions; 3) Finally block ensures that the code is always executed; 4) throw is used to manually throw exceptions. These mechanisms help improve the robustness and maintainability of your code.

The main function of anonymous classes in PHP is to create one-time objects. 1. Anonymous classes allow classes without names to be directly defined in the code, which is suitable for temporary requirements. 2. They can inherit classes or implement interfaces to increase flexibility. 3. Pay attention to performance and code readability when using it, and avoid repeatedly defining the same anonymous classes.
